/* projectflexpages */

body#projectflex td.maincontent,
div.maincontent {
	width:616px;
	padding:0px ! important;
	height: 500px ! important;
	background-color:#FFFFFF;
	overflow: hidden ! important;
	}

/* PAGE NAVIGATION */
div.pagenavigation {
	position: absolute;
	top: 777px;
	float: left; 
	width:198px;
	padding-left:48px;
	height: 40px;
	background-color: transparent;
	}
/*
div.pagenavigation div.fill {
	width: 187px;
	}
*/
div.pagenavigation img.spacer-gif {
	display: none;
	}
div.pagenavigation table.contenttable {
	width: 164px;
	}
div.pagenavigation table.contenttable p {
	padding: 0px;
	margin: 0px;
	}
div.pagenavigation table.contenttable td.align-right {
	text-align: right;
	}
div.pagenavigation img {
	border: 1px solid #ffffff;
	}

/* 1 PICTURE TOP */
/*
div.toppic {
	width: 616px;
	max-height: 250px;
	}
div.toppic * {
	margin: 0px ! important;
	padding: 0px ! important;
	overflow: hidden;
	} */
div.csc-frame-frame1 {
	height: 250px;
	overflow: hidden;
	}
div.csc-frame-frame2 {
	height: 500px;
	overflow: hidden;
	}

div.flexcontent {
	float: left;
	}

div.flexcontent div.csc-textpic-text {
	background:none;
	line-height:14px;
	}

div.flexcontent div.csc-textpic-imagewrap {
	width:369px ! important;
	float: right;
	max-height: 500px ! important;
	padding: 0px;
	overflow: hidden ! important;
	}
div.flexcontent div.csc-textpic-imagewrap * {
	overflow: hidden ! important;
	margin: 0px ! important;
	padding: 0px ! important;
	}

body#projectflex h1 {
	color:#7f7f83;
}
div.flexcontent h1 {
	padding-top:42px;
	margin-bottom: 10px;
	margin-left:48px;
	margin-right:10px;
/*	max-width: 534px; */
	}
div.flexcontent p,
div.flexcontent h2,
div.flexcontent h3,
div.flexcontent h4,
div.flexcontent h5,
div.flexcontent h6 {
	margin-top:0px;
	margin-left:48px;
	margin-right:10px;
	max-width: 534px;
	}



